    Chargers-Patriots takeaways: Drake Maye leads New England to postseason win

    Team_Prime US NewsBy Team_Prime US NewsJanuary 12, 2026No Comments1 Min Read
    Share Facebook Twitter Pinterest LinkedIn Tumblr Reddit Telegram Email
    Share
    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est Email


    In the one sport of the NFL‘s wild-card weekend thus far that was not determined by one rating, Drake Maye put collectively an enormous second-half effort to steer the New England Patriots previous the Los Angeles Chargers, 16-3.

    Listed below are 4 takeaways from New England’s win on Sunday night time:

    Drake Maye overcomes sluggish begin in dominant Patriots win

    There might have solely been one TD mixed within the sport, however New England was answerable for this one for a lot of the night time, thanks largely to its stout protection that solely allowed 207 complete yards.

    Whereas that was spectacular, Maye was not too unhealthy himself, going 17-of-29 for 268 yards with one TD and one interception. He additionally tacked on 10 carries for 66 yards and showcased his mobility. This TD move to tight finish Hunter Henry, although, blew the sport open within the fourth quarter.
